CASA Program Recruiting Volunteers Amid Pandemic
Apr 5, 2020 by Audrey LilleyThe pandemic has affected many activities, including how the CASA program trains its volunteers. Court Appointed Special Advocates (CASA) of Lancaster County provides qualified and compassionate volunteers to advocate for children in foster care. They strive to provide a CASA Volunteer to each child who needs one.

Changing Lives in Elizabethtown
Apr 1, 2019 by Deb JonesThe Elizabethtown Area HUB (oeEHUB") is a collaboration of community social service agencies serving the northwest quadrant of Lancaster County. This collective impact partnership began it™s expanded collective efforts in July 2015 through an initial grant by United Way of Lancaster County.
